Franco Fichtner <fra...@opnsense.org> changed: What |Removed |Added ---------------------------------------------------------------------------- CC| |fra...@opnsense.org --- Comment #3 from Franco Fichtner <fra...@opnsense.org> --- It appears that crypto parts of Python simply require legacy.so to be present for OpenSSL 3 by default. In security/openssl that is the LEGACY option, which is also off by default. Should each Python port be modified to add CRYPTOGRAPHY_OPENSSL_NO_LEGACY=1 ? The comment in the patch is misleading: "If you did not expect this error, you have likely made a mistake with your OpenSSL configuration."
